VDOE collects information related to student enrollment and staffing to ensure that school divisions receive the appropriate state and federal funds. Information including instructions and submission templates for upcoming data collections is posted here.

Financial Data Collections

Annual School Report – Financial Section (ASRFIN) 2021-2022 - Due: September 15, 2022

The 2021-2022 Annual School Report data collection is due to the Department of Education as required by Section 22.1-81 of the Code of Virginia. 

This application is completed in the Single Sign-on for Web Systems (SSWS) portal.  The ASRFIN Excel Template, Instructions, Chart of Accounts, Adjusted Locality Ledger, Sales Tax, and EOY Basic Aid Adjustments reports are accessed in the ASRFIN application in SSWS. Log in to SSWS, select Annual School Report: Financial (ASRFIN), and then select Instructions on the upper right side of the screen for all ASRFIN documentation. 

Budgeted Required Local Effort and Required Local Match – Fiscal Year 2023 - Due: July 22, 2022

The FY 2023 Budgeted Required Local Effort and Required Local Match data collection is due to the Department of Education as required by Item 137 of Chapter 2, 2022 Special Session I Acts of Assembly (2022 Appropriation Act).

  • Superintendent’s Memo 139-22 (PDF): This application is completed in the Single Sign-on for Web Systems (SSWS) portal. Log into SSWS, Select Required Local Effort And Required Local Match (RLERLM), and then select Instructions on the right side of the screen. Located here are step-by-step instructions, Relevant Legal Citations, and the Projected FY 2023 SOQ RLE and Optional RLM amounts based on Chapter 2, 2022 Special Session I Acts of Assembly, and List of Qualifying Schools for Reading Specialists and Math/Reading Instructional Specialists.

Foster Care – Fiscal Year 2023 Reimbursement for Local Operational Costs Incurred During Fiscal Year 2022 (July 1, 2021 - June 30, 2022) - Due: July 31, 2022

To receive state payment for the cost of providing services to certain children placed in foster care, divisions are required to provide data related to those services. This application is completed in the Single Sign-on for Web Systems (SSWS) portal; The Foster Care Excel template and instructions are now accessed in the Foster Care Enrollment application in SSWS under Instructions on the right side of the screen.
